Cuisine

Yardımlı, Azerbaijan offers a diverse and flavorful cuisine that reflects the country's rich culinary heritage. The local food is known for its use of fresh herbs, aromatic spices, and a wide variety of meats and vegetables. Traditional Azerbaijani cuisine often features dishes cooked in clay pots, skewered meats grilled over open flames, and an array of savory pastries.

Famous Food

Signature dishes, delicacies and famous food

Dolma

A popular dish consisting of vine leaves stuffed with a flavorful mixture of minced meat, rice, and aromatic spices. It is often served with a dollop of yogurt.

Must-Try!

Piti

A hearty stew made with lamb or beef, chickpeas, and vegetables, slow-cooked in individual clay pots. Piti is traditionally enjoyed with a sprinkling of fresh herbs and a wedge of lemon.

Lavangi

Lavangi is a delicious dish featuring fish or chicken stuffed with a mixture of walnuts, onions, and fragrant herbs before being roasted to perfection.

Weather

Located in the southern part of Azerbaijan, the climate in this region is characterized by a humid subtropical climate. Summers are typically hot, with temperatures often exceeding 30°C (86°F), while winters are mild and can experience temperatures around 5-10°C (41-50°F). Precipitation is relatively moderate, with the bulk of rainfall occurring during the spring and autumn months. This region benefits from a diverse climate that supports various types of vegetation, including lush forests and agricultural lands in the surrounding areas. The proximity to the Caspian Sea can also influence local weather patterns, leading to variations in temperature and humidity. Overall, the climate supports a rich biodiversity, contributing to both the natural beauty and agricultural productivity of the area.

Tipping & Payment

Ensure a smooth experience

Tipping

In Yardımlı, Azerbaijan, tipping is a common practice, particularly in the service industry. It is usually given for good service in restaurants, cafes, and for taxi drivers. The standard practice is to round up the bill or leave a small percentage of the total amount, typically around 5-10%. However, tipping is not obligatory, and it often depends on the customer's satisfaction with the service.

Payment

Payment methods in Yardımlı include cash and, increasingly, card payments. Cash is still widely used, especially in smaller shops and markets. However, more restaurants and larger establishments are beginning to accept credit and debit cards. Bank transfers and mobile payment applications are also gaining popularity among the younger population, making transactions more convenient.

Best Time to Visit

And what to expect in different seasons...

Spring

Spring (March to May) is considered one of the best times to visit Yardımlı. The temperatures are mild, ranging from 10°C to 20°C, and the landscape comes alive with blooming flowers and lush greenery. It is a great time for outdoor activities such as hiking and exploring the region's natural beauty.

Summer

Summer (June to August) in Yardımlı can be quite warm, with temperatures often reaching up to 30°C. However, the higher elevation of the region makes it more pleasant than in lower areas. Summer is ideal for enjoying the scenery and participating in cultural festivals, although visitors should be prepared for occasional heatwaves.

Autumn

Autumn (September to November) is another excellent time to visit, as temperatures begin to cool, ranging from 15°C to 25°C. The fall foliage offers stunning views and is perfect for photography. The weather is generally dry and comfortable for activities such as exploring local markets and historical sites.

Winter

Winter (December to February) can be cold, with temperatures dropping to around 0°C, especially at night. While snowfall is less common in Yardımlı, some colder days can occur. This season is quieter, offering a chance to experience local traditions and cozy indoor activities. It's ideal for those seeking a peaceful and serene environment.
